What is Washington Adventist University's acceptance rate?

Washington Adventist University's acceptance rate is 45% for the most recent year available. This makes it selective.

What SAT score do I need for Washington Adventist University?

The middle 50% SAT range at Washington Adventist University is 800 to 1100. Scoring above 1100 puts you in the top quartile of admitted students.
